Output 893eb541ebbd2f51e14aeef9edb5f510fc4c168eb32709dfa81e89128ae6067b:0

value
386761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af103f63d27c366a2d4f5ad005cb689d8ee73b9f OP_EQUAL
address
3Hefe21nZoejN5MPFvLAp5qRLZDvUSodgT
transaction
893eb541ebbd2f51e14aeef9edb5f510fc4c168eb32709dfa81e89128ae6067b
spent
true